Olsztyńska Piątka is a free 5 km running series for Olsztyn residents, held in Park im. Janusza Kusocińskiego behind Aquasfera. Fundacja SportAktywni organizes it for the city’s sport and recreation centre, funded by the Olsztyn Civic Budget, meaning runners face no entry fee. The main race is for individuals aged 16 and over, limited to 150 participants, and children’s races are also part of the event.
The 5 km course remains entirely on park paths, defining it as a local race rather than a city-wide road event. Children up to 16 compete in age-appropriate distances of 100 m, 300 m, 400 m, or 1000 m, with 50 spots available for these races. The schedule covers race-office hours, number collection, the children’s races, the main 5 km event, and medal presentations. Certain editions are designated as the Grand Prix Parku Kusocińskiego, featuring spring, summer, and autumn 5 km races within the same park.
